The main tasks and work activities of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education are to set up classroom materials or equipment, provide for basic needs of children, teach life skills, establish rules or policies governing student behavior. In general, for the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education, speaking, instructing, active Listening, learning Strategies and other 13 skills are required.

General Job Description and Education/Training Levels for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education

Most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education occupations in this zone require training in vocational schools, related on-the-job experience, or an associate's degree. 28.75% of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education have High School Diploma (or the equivalent) and 10.34% of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education have Post-Secondary Certificate. The following graph shows the percentage of earned degrees held by Preschool Teachers, Except Special Education occupational group.
Less than a High School Diploma
0.00%
High School Diploma (or the equivalent)
28.75%
Post-Secondary Certificate
10.34%
Some College Courses
12.17%
Associate's Degree (or other 2-year degree)
11.55%
Bachelor's Degree and Above
37.19%
